Market Overview
On February 25, XRP experienced a significant rebound, driven by positive sentiment in the crypto market stemming from ETF inflows and legislative developments. The optimism surrounding the Market Structure Bill, which aims to clarify the regulatory framework for cryptocurrencies, has been a key factor in boosting demand for XRP.
Legislative Developments
Recent discussions in Washington have focused on reaching an agreement on stablecoin yields, which has further fueled interest in XRP. The White House has set a deadline for March 1 for a draft text of the Market Structure Bill, creating urgency among stakeholders in the banking and crypto sectors to find common ground.
Historically, XRP has shown sensitivity to legislative changes, as evidenced by its price movements following the passage of the Market Structure Bill in July 2025.
ETF Market Dynamics
The US BTC-spot ETF market has seen a resurgence in demand, with net inflows of $257.7 million reported on February 24, reversing previous outflows. This trend is crucial as Bitcoin often serves as a barometer for the broader crypto market, influencing XRP's price movements.

Risks to the Outlook
Several factors could impact XRP's price trajectory negatively, including:
- Escalation of geopolitical tensions, particularly involving the US and Iran.
- Economic indicators that may lower expectations for a Federal Reserve rate cut.
- Delays or opposition to the Market Structure Bill.
- Extended periods of net outflows from XRP-spot ETFs.
Technical Analysis
XRP closed at $1.4335 after a 6.27% rally on February 25, outperforming the broader crypto market. However, it remains below its 50-day and 200-day EMAs, indicating a bearish bias. Key technical levels to monitor include:
- Support Levels: $1.0, $0.7773
- Resistance Levels: $1.5, $2.0, $2.5, $3.0
